Output 8590bcf269d4ea536fc018f5efc74c011f94e3e9364e1d93181a1bfb76478b1a:0

value
1077065773
script pubkey
OP_0 OP_PUSHBYTES_20 14d942170a861ed5d7cd09aca26e8f6e7ab4d4b3
address
ltc1qznv5y9c2sc0dt47dpxk2ym50deatf49ny5js2g
transaction
8590bcf269d4ea536fc018f5efc74c011f94e3e9364e1d93181a1bfb76478b1a
spent
true